Benthic foraminifera distribution in a tourist lagoon in Rio de Janeiro, Brazil: a response to anthropogenic impacts

Abstract:Rodrigo de Freitas Lagoon, located in the Rio de Janeiro City, receives several types of polluted discharges. The knowledge of the sediment microfauna correlated with heavy metal and organic matter concentrations could supply important data about the conditions of the lagoon. The benthic foraminiferal assemblage presented larger diversity and more abundant samples in the lagoon entrance than in the inner area. The Ammonia tepida - Elphidiumexcavatum foraminiferal assemblage is characterized by dwarf, corroded and weak organisms. Agglutinated species were found only near the entrance. Low abundance values and sterility of five samples in the inner area (north/northeast) can be caused by high levels of heavy metals and organic matter. A. tepida shows negative correlation with increasing heavy metals values. PAHs and coprostanol high indexes, and the absence or low presence of microfauna in samples around the lagoon margin confirm illegal flows from gas stations and domestic sewage.
